In addition to the sexual assault medical forensic examination service (paid for by Washington State Department of Labor & Industries, Crime Victims Compensation), grant funded activities may include: Providing immediate response Evaluating and managing patients Preserving, managing, and tracking evidence Providing information, referrals, and follow up Coordinating responses with other professionals, such as Community Sexual Assault Programs or Children’s Advocacy Centers Participating in multidisciplinary team (MDT) or sexual assault response team (SART) meetings Report writing Peer review Outreach and education to the public about sexual assault and available resources Preparing for and testifying in court Consulting with other providers, disciplines, and systems
